The kitchen buzzed with excitement as I rolled out a sheet of flaky puff pastry, ready to whip up my latest obsession: Cranberry Cream Cheese Pinwheels with Feta & Herbs. These delightful bites are not only simple to prepare but also perfect for any festive gathering, bringing a burst of color and flavor to your appetizer spread. With just a handful of ingredients, these vegetarian pinwheels can be prepped in advance, allowing you to focus on enjoying time with your loved ones. Trust me, the combination of creamy cream cheese, tangy feta, and the tart notes of cranberries wrapped in golden pastry is irresistible. Who’s ready to impress their guests with these make-ahead delights?

Why Are These Pinwheels So Irresistible?
Vibrant Flavors: The combination of creamy cheese, tangy feta, and sweet-tart cranberries creates a symphony of taste in every bite.
Easy Prep: With just a few simple ingredients, you can whip these up in no time! They’re perfect for busy hosts looking to make a statement without the fuss.
Make-Ahead Magic: Prepare them in advance and simply bake before your guests arrive, giving you more time to enjoy the party!
Festive Appeal: Their bright colors and delightful presentation make them an eye-catching appetizer, ideal for holiday gatherings.
Vegetarian Delight: These pinwheels cater to plant-based eaters without sacrificing flavor, making them a hit among all your guests.
Pair them with our Baked Chicken Cheese for a complete appetizer spread!
Cranberry Cream Cheese Pinwheels Ingredients
For the Pinwheel Filling
- Cream Cheese – Softened for smooth blending; ensures a creamy texture in your pinwheels.
- Feta Cheese – Crumbled for easy mixing; adds a salty, tangy twist that complements the cranberries.
- Fresh Herbs (Parsley, Thyme, or Rosemary) – Chopped finely for aromatic freshness; brings brightness to the filling.
- Cranberries – Use fresh or dried; fresh offers tartness while dried adds sweetness, adaptable for different palates.
For the Pastry
- Puff Pastry – Thawed and rolled out; creates flaky layers that wrap the filling beautifully.
- Egg (for egg wash) – Beaten to create a golden-brown finish; gives your pinwheels that gorgeous shine when baked.
Consider preparing these Cranberry Cream Cheese Pinwheels with Feta & Herbs a day ahead to delight your guests with effortless elegance!
Step‑by‑Step Instructions for Cranberry Cream Cheese Pinwheels with Feta & Herbs
Step 1: Preheat the Oven
Begin by preheating your oven to 400°F (200°C). This ensures that your Cranberry Cream Cheese Pinwheels with Feta & Herbs bake evenly and achieve that wonderful golden-brown finish. While the oven heats up, prepare your workspace so everything is within reach, making the process smoother.
Step 2: Roll Out the Puff Pastry
On a lightly floured surface, roll out the thawed puff pastry into an even rectangle, approximately ¼-inch thick. This will provide a sturdy yet flaky base for your filling. A lightly floured rolling pin makes this task easier. Aim for an even thickness to ensure consistent baking across all pinwheels.
Step 3: Mix the Filling
In a mixing bowl, combine the softened cream cheese, crumbled feta, and your choice of finely chopped fresh herbs. Blend until smooth, giving it a vibrant, creamy consistency. This step is crucial as the creaminess of the filling will contrast beautifully with the crispy pastry and tart cranberries.
Step 4: Spread the Filling
Using a spatula, spread the cream cheese mixture evenly over the rolled-out puff pastry, leaving a small border around the edges. Ensuring an even layer allows each bite of your Cranberry Cream Cheese Pinwheels with Feta & Herbs to have a perfect balance of flavors.
Step 5: Add the Cranberries
Sprinkle your cranberries over the cream cheese filling, distributing them evenly. Feel free to use fresh or dried cranberries—each brings a delightful flavor twist to the pinwheels. If you prefer fresh cranberries, roughly chop them and consider adding a bit of sugar to balance their tartness.
Step 6: Roll the Pastry
Starting from one long edge, carefully roll the pastry tightly into a log shape. This rolling technique is essential to keep the filling snug and prevent it from spilling out during baking. Be gentle to avoid tearing the pastry, but aim for a tight roll for the best pinwheel shape.
Step 7: Slice the Pinwheels
Using a sharp knife, slice the log into ½-inch thick pieces. As you cut, you will see the beautiful swirls of filling, ready to be baked. Position these slices cut-side up on a parchment-lined baking sheet to help prevent sticking and promote even cooking.
Step 8: Brush with Egg Wash
In a small bowl, beat your egg and use a pastry brush to apply it over the tops of each pinwheel. This egg wash is key to achieving that shiny, golden-brown crust that makes your Cranberry Cream Cheese Pinwheels with Feta & Herbs look incredibly appetizing.
Step 9: Bake to Perfection
Place the baking sheet in the preheated oven and bake for 15–20 minutes. Keep an eye on the pinwheels as they puff up and turn golden brown. The delightful aroma will fill your kitchen, signaling that they are nearly ready to be enjoyed.
Step 10: Cool and Serve
Once baked, remove the pinwheels from the oven and let them cool slightly on the baking sheet. This brief cooling allows the flavors to settle. Serve warm to fully enjoy the creamy filling and flaky pastry, showcasing your delicious Cranberry Cream Cheese Pinwheels with Feta & Herbs at your next gathering!

Expert Tips for Cranberry Cream Cheese Pinwheels
-
Soften Cream Cheese: Ensure your cream cheese is at room temperature before mixing to avoid lumps and achieve a silky filling.
-
Choose Your Cranberries: If using fresh cranberries, consider chopping them and sprinkling with sugar to tame their tartness. Dried cranberries add a sweeter touch!
-
Rolling Technique: Roll the pastry tightly to ensure the cranberry cream cheese pinwheels hold their shape. Loose rolls may cause the filling to spill out during baking.
-
Evenly Slice: Use a sharp knife to slice the log into uniform pieces; this guarantees even baking, so each pinwheel is golden brown and delicious.
-
Egg Wash for Shine: Don’t skip the egg wash! Brushing the pinwheels creates a beautiful golden-brown finish that makes them even more appealing.
-
Storage Tips: Store leftovers in an airtight container in the fridge for up to 3 days. Reheat at 350°F (175°C) for a few minutes to restore their flaky texture.
What to Serve with Cranberry Cream Cheese Pinwheels with Feta & Herbs
Elevate your festive appetizer spread with these delightful pairings that will leave your guests raving.
-
Creamy Mashed Potatoes: The buttery richness of mashed potatoes provides a comforting contrast to the tangy pinwheels, making for a well-rounded meal.
-
Fresh Garden Salad: Crisp greens with a zesty vinaigrette bring brightness, balancing the creamy richness of the pinwheels. This freshness will enliven your palate!
-
Roasted Vegetables: Seasoned roasted veggies offer a hearty and colorful companion, amplifying the meal’s texture while enhancing the earthy flavors of herbs.
-
Crunchy Breadsticks: Delightfully crisp and airy, breadsticks are perfect for dipping into sauces or enjoying alongside the pinwheels, enhancing the overall experience.
-
Herbed Yogurt Dip: A cool yogurt-based dip, infused with garlic and fresh herbs, harmonizes beautifully with the pinwheels, providing a refreshing contrast.
-
Fruit Platter: A medley of fresh fruits adds a burst of sweetness that complements the tartness of the cranberries, creating a vibrant, colorful display.
-
Sparkling Wine: A glass of bubbly adds elegance to your gathering, its effervescence cutting through the creaminess of the pinwheels for an uplifting refreshment.
-
Dark Chocolate Squares: End your gathering on a sweet note; the luxurious bitterness of dark chocolate pairs surprisingly well with the tart cranberries.
These pairings will elevate your gathering and transform your festive celebration into an unforgettable culinary experience!
Storage Tips for Cranberry Cream Cheese Pinwheels
Room Temperature: Enjoy the pinwheels warm right after baking, as they are best served fresh! However, they can stay at room temperature for about 2 hours for gatherings.
Fridge: Store leftover cranberry cream cheese pinwheels in an airtight container for up to 3 days. Make sure they are cooled completely before sealing to prevent sogginess.
Freezer: For longer storage, freeze pinwheels before baking. Wrap each tightly in plastic wrap and store in a freezer bag for up to 2 months. Bake from frozen, adding a few extra minutes to the cooking time.
Reheating: To enjoy leftovers, reheat refrigerated pinwheels in an oven at 350°F (175°C) for about 5–7 minutes until warmed through and crispy again.
Cranberry Cream Cheese Pinwheels Variations
Feel free to get creative with these pinwheels and make them your own—every twist brings new deliciousness!
-
Goat Cheese: Swap out feta for creamy goat cheese to give your pinwheels a rich, tangy flavor. This alternative adds an extra layer of decadence that your guests will love.
-
Nutty Crunch: Add chopped walnuts or pecans to the filling for delightful texture and added crunch. The nuttiness beautifully complements the creaminess of the cheese and tartness of the cranberries.
-
Herb Swap: Experiment with different herbs, like fresh basil or dill, to personalize the flavor profile. Each herb brings a distinct taste that can elevate your pinwheel game to new heights.
-
Spicy Kick: For a fiery twist, mix in a pinch of red pepper flakes or finely chopped jalapeños. This touch of heat can balance the sweetness of the cranberries superbly.
-
Sweet Twist: Drizzle some honey or maple syrup over the filling before rolling for a delightful sweet contrast. The sweetness elevates the comforting flavors of these pinwheels, making them even more irresistible.
-
Chive Infusion: Let’s not forget about chives! Stirring in finely chopped chives gives a lovely oniony flavor, enhancing your filling’s depth while keeping it light and fresh.
-
Wrapped in Bacon: For those who enjoy a savory twist, wrap each pinwheel in bacon before baking. The crispy, salty bacon complements the creamy filling remarkably, taking these bites to the next level.
Pair these fun variations with a refreshing dip, perhaps something yogurt-based like a cool avocado sauce, for a well-rounded appetizer experience. Don’t forget to check out our delightful Cottage Cheese Blueberry Cloud Bread for an equally exciting flavor adventure!
Make Ahead Options
These Cranberry Cream Cheese Pinwheels with Feta & Herbs are ideal for meal prep, saving you time on busy days or during festive gatherings! You can prepare the pinwheels up to 24 hours in advance by rolling them into logs and slicing them, then placing the slices on a parchment-lined baking sheet. Cover them tightly with plastic wrap and refrigerate until you’re ready to bake. This not only keeps them fresh but also allows the flavors to meld beautifully. When it’s time to serve, simply brush with egg wash and bake—these delicious pinwheels will be just as flavorful and flaky, allowing you to enjoy stress-free entertaining!

Cranberry Cream Cheese Pinwheels with Feta & Herbs Recipe FAQs
How do I choose the right cranberries for my pinwheels?
Absolutely! For the best flavor, use fresh cranberries that are firm and bright in color, avoiding any that have dark spots. If you prefer dried cranberries, ensure they’re plump and sweetened, as they’ll add a delightful sweetness to your pinwheels.
What’s the best way to store leftover pinwheels?
Very simple! Store any leftovers in an airtight container in the refrigerator for up to 3 days. Allow the pinwheels to cool completely before sealing to avoid moisture buildup, which could make them soggy.
Can I freeze cranberry cream cheese pinwheels?
Absolutely! For longer storage, wrap each uncooked pinwheel tightly in plastic wrap and place them in a freezer bag. They can be frozen for up to 2 months. When you’re ready to bake, you can take them directly from the freezer to the oven—just add an extra 5 minutes to the baking time for perfect pinwheels!
What if my pinwheels don’t puff up properly during baking?
Very common! Ensure your puff pastry is sufficiently thawed and rolled out evenly. If it’s too cold when it goes in the oven, it won’t rise properly. Additionally, brush the tops with egg wash for that golden color and to help them puff beautifully.
Are these pinwheels suitable for vegetarians?
Yes, indeed! With no meat ingredients used, the Cranberry Cream Cheese Pinwheels with Feta & Herbs are a delicious and satisfying vegetarian option. Always double-check the labels of your ingredients to ensure they meet your dietary needs!
How should I serve these pinwheels for best presentation?
Make it festive! Serve the pinwheels warm, garnished with fresh herbs on a beautiful platter. Consider pairing them with a yogurt-based dip featuring fresh garlic and herbs for an extra touch of flavor that compliments the creamy filling. Enjoy!

Cranberry Cream Cheese Pinwheels with Feta & Herbs Bliss
Ingredients
Equipment
Method
- Preheat your oven to 400°F (200°C).
- Roll out the thawed puff pastry into an even rectangle, approximately ¼-inch thick.
- In a mixing bowl, combine the softened cream cheese, crumbled feta, and finely chopped fresh herbs. Blend until smooth.
- Spread the cream cheese mixture evenly over the rolled-out puff pastry, leaving a small border around the edges.
- Sprinkle cranberries over the cream cheese filling, distributing them evenly.
- From one long edge, roll the pastry tightly into a log shape.
- Slice the log into ½-inch thick pieces and position them cut-side up on a parchment-lined baking sheet.
- Brush the tops of each pinwheel with the egg wash.
- Bake for 15–20 minutes until golden brown.
- Remove from the oven and let cool slightly before serving.

Leave a Reply